6 p.m. on GOLF, ‘‘The Haney Project’’ — Olympic swimmer Michael Phelps is the latest celebrity to go under the tutelage of swing coach Hank Haney for the series’ fifth season. ‘‘As I enter this next chapter of my life, I think I will be able to shift my competitiveness to anything I put my mind to, and golf is one of the things I want to focus on,’’ Phelps says. ‘‘I want to play all the world’s great golf courses, but I’d like to play them well.’’ First lesson: Stay out of the water.

8 p.m. on 6, ‘‘How I Met Your Mother’’ - Barney (Neil Patrick Harris) breaks out his famous playbook to help Ted (Josh Radnor) find a new girlfriend after he and Jeanette (Abby Elliot) split up. Robin (Cobie Smulders) is not pleased; she thought he destroyed the book. Lily (Alyson Hannigan) hopes to make a good impression at a gallery opening, but it’s Marshall (Jason Segel) who gets the attention in the new episode ‘‘Weekend at Barney’s.’’

8 p.m. on 10, ‘‘Bones’’ — An eccentric new intern (Brian Klugman) comes to work at the Jeffersonian and inspires Brennan (Emily Deschanel) to try being more open-minded about questions of science. When she seriously considers time travel as a factor in the murder they’re investigating, however, Booth (David Boreanaz) thinks she’s taking that open-mindedness too far. Michaela Conlin also stars in the new episode ‘‘The Fact in the Fiction.’’

9 p.m. on 10, ‘‘The Following’’ — After a new follower (Tom Lipinski) makes Carroll’s (James Purefoy) true intentions known, Hardy (Kevin Bacon) tries to turn Emma, Jacob and Paul (Valorie Curry, Nico Tortorella, Adan Canto) against one another in hopes of stalling them. Emma makes a decision that shocks everyone in the new episode ‘‘The Fall.’’

9 p.m. on TNT, ‘‘Dallas’’ — As John Ross (Josh Henderson) continues putting pressure on Sue Ellen (Linda Gray) to help him take control of Ewing Energies, Christopher (Jesse Metcalfe) drops a bombshell that could change the company’s future. Christopher and Pamela (Julie Gonzalo) work on settling their divorce. An outsider’s attempt to undermine the Ewings brings the family together in the new episode ‘‘Blame Game.’’

9:30 p.m. on 6, ‘‘Mike & Molly’’ — Retail therapy — gotta love it. Molly and Mike (Melissa McCarthy, Billy Gardell) get into an argument at the mall, and Mike storms off. She reacts by going on a shopping spree in the new episode ‘‘Molly’s New Shoes.’’
